Bands need money from merch and tips just to survive and a new app from Nashville software company DevDigital is making it easier to give a tip to your favorite bands.

The apps founder, Will Mulligan came up with the idea for the app after a live show and put the software firm to work.

The MyTIpJar app, available on both Android and iPhone, enables fans to tip directly from their phone after download and a less than 2 minute account set up.

With band revenue down, we hope this becomes a way for an artist to earn the money necessary to stay artists, and keep producing the music that is the life blood of this and many other cities around the country, said Founder Will Mulligan.

MyTipJar goes beyond just being a mobile app for tips. The website allows the artists to put in profile information, showcase upcoming shows and link to their website. New features are already in development to allow upload of music tracks for download and social sharing.

People using the app are able to see who is playing nearby with geo-location functionality allowing users to see other bands near them, and search venues for upcoming events.

With over 75 bands already signed up, there is great anticipation for viral growth and adoption by fans. MyTipJar waited to make a major push until it was available on both Android and iPhone to gain downloads as quickly as possible.

“We didn’t want to leave out 67% of the smartphone owners in the country. It’s important to us for bands to really gain from promoting the app, and for fans to show their appreciation,” said John Maddox, investor in MyTip Jar

The app is pretty cut and dry bands make money from tips from their fans. An e-wallet type platform allows users and band fans to donate tips using a credit card rather than cash or change.
